How they compare
Saint Lucia currently reports 6,195 against 4,765 in Antigua and Barbuda, a difference of 1,430.
That makes Saint Lucia's figure about 1.3 times Antigua and Barbuda's.
Across all 12 years both countries report, Saint Lucia has been ahead every year.
Antigua and Barbuda ranks 178th and Saint Lucia ranks 175th of 200 countries.
Saint Lucia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Antigua and Barbuda | Saint Lucia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 5,099 | 9,696 | 4,597 | Saint Lucia |
| 2010s | 5,432 | 8,216 | 2,784 | Saint Lucia |
| 2020s | 4,694 | 6,591 | 1,896 | Saint Lucia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
